As of April 2026, the official Iron Man 3 JARVIS Second Screen

app is no longer available for download on the iOS App Store. Originally released in 2013 to promote the movie's Blu-ray release, the app was eventually removed by Marvel and has become incompatible with modern iOS versions. App History & Legacy Original Release: September 10, 2013.

Primary Purpose: A "Second Screen" experience that allowed users to control the Iron Man 3 Blu-ray via voice commands and unlock 42 unique Iron Man suits. Key Features:

Authentic Voice: Featured over 200 custom lines recorded by Paul Bettany, the original voice of JARVIS.

Utility Tools: Included an alarm clock, weather updates, and the ability to post to social media using voice commands.

Blu-ray Integration: Required both the iOS device and Blu-ray player to be on the same Wi-Fi network for syncing. Current "Jarvis" Apps on iOS

The Iron Man 3: J.A.R.V.I.S. – A Second Screen Experience app was a high-tech utility released on September 10, 2013, to coincide with the film's Blu-ray launch. While it was once the ultimate fan experience, it has since been discontinued and largely removed from the App Store. Current Availability & Download Status

As of 2026, the original app is no longer officially supported or available for modern iOS devices:

Official Removal: The app was pulled from the App Store years ago by Marvel/Disney.

Incompatibility: Even if you previously downloaded it, the app is incompatible with modern iOS versions (it was built for 32-bit architecture and broke after major iOS updates).

Marvel Database Rebrand: A later version titled "Jarvis: Powered by Marvel" appeared but was criticized for removing all original J.A.R.V.I.S. utility features, serving instead as a simple hero database.

Android Alternative: Some Android users still attempt to use the original features via unofficial APK files, though functionality is limited. Original App Features

At its peak, the app featured approximately 20 hours of original voice-over by Paul Bettany, the voice of J.A.R.V.I.S. in the films. Marvel's Iron Man 3 - JARVIS: A Second Screen Experience

Part 4: Why Marvel Killed the Best Movie Tie-In App

It is heartbreaking for fans. The Iron Man 3 JARVIS app was ahead of its time. It used "audio watermarking" for theater integration—tech that is now standard in Disney+ second-screen features.

The app was taken down for three technical reasons:

  1. 32-bit Apocalypse: iOS 11 dropped support for all 32-bit apps. Rewriting the complex AR and audio code for 64-bit was deemed too expensive for a promotional tie-in.
  2. Server Shutdown: The "House Party Protocol" and remote missions required backend servers. Disney turned those servers off in 2017.
  3. Licensing: Paul Bettany’s voice rights for the app were limited to a 5-year contract.
